In this key role, you will be responsible for preparing and dispensing many types of pharmaceuticals to fulfill orders in the inpatient pharmacies. You will float between medication reconciliation and inpatient pharmacy departments to ensure seamless and efficient medication management. You will collaborate closely with other members of the health care team to help prevent inappropriate or misuse of medications. Adhering to departmental policies and procedures, you will deliver a wide range of clinical services (e.g., pharmacokinetic dosing, therapeutic interchange, IV/PO conversions, TPN per pharmacy, pharmacist interventions). Schedule:
Varied 10-hour shifts, depending on department needs, including weekends and holidaysHourly Salary Range:
$90.16-$105.61 (Union represented, step based salary depending on years of experience)Bargaining Unit:
HX-UPTE Qualifications We're seeking a dedicated clinical professional with: Pharm D. degree and current CA Pharmacy license (required). ASHP-accredited residency (preferred). 2 years inpatient pharmacy experience (highly preferred). Exceptional communication, interpersonal, organizational and follow-through skills. Knowledge of and ability to perform age specific and disease specific pharmacokinetic calculations.
